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Middle Hill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Middle Hill with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Middle Hill is at East Liberty Properties listed at $820.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Middle Hill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Middle Hill is $1,980.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Middle Hill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Middle Hill is a 1,500 square feet unit starting from $3,000 at Etage Apartments.
What is the average size for Middle Hill 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Middle Hill is currently 951 sq ft.
